标签:comm 做了 xxxx fetch 项目 开发者 str 没有 git
最近在参加阿里天池大数据中间件比赛(毫无头绪,打酱油中).看参赛要求,需要将官网的git工程clone下来,在此基础上做修改后提交到自己的仓库中.
由于以前并没有使用过git,所以差了比较多的资料,做了不少尝试,现在终于搞成了.
主要参考了这个链接:http://blog.csdn.net/killzero/article/details/10441169
1.首先需要在git仓库中建立自己的工程,我这直接fork了官方demo,地址为:git@code.aliyun.com:middlewarerace2017/open-messaging-demo.git
fork成功后获取到自己工程的git地址:git@code.aliyun.com:xxxxxxxxx/open-messaging-demo.git
2.将fork的demo clone到本地:
git clone git@code.aliyun.com:xxxxxxx/open-messaging-demo.git
3.进入clone出来的工程目录, 添加与原始库的关联,命名为upstream,此地址是原项目开发者的项目主页上的clone的地址:这是专门用来与主开发者保持相同进度的方法:
git remote upstream git@code.aliyun.com:middlewarerace2017/open-messaging-demo.git
4.使用fetch命令可以从原始库中抓取最新的更新
git fetch upstream
5.在本地修改代码文件并PUSH到自己的git仓库
git commit -a -m ‘更新原因‘
git push git@code.aliyun.com:xxxxxxxxx/open-messaging-demo.git
标签:comm 做了 xxxx fetch 项目 开发者 str 没有 git
原文地址:http://www.cnblogs.com/qj4d/p/6883157.html